Materials:
- White cardstock or construction paper
- Red and green construction paper
- Scissors
- Glue stick or craft glue
- Ruler
- Pencil
- Glitter (optional)
- Ribbon or string (for hanging)
Full Step-by-Step:
1. Prepare Your Base
- Cut a piece of white cardstock to your desired size for the base of your Candy Cane Stripes. Aim for a landscape orientation for more space to work with.
2. Create Candy Cane Stripes
- Using your ruler and pencil, lightly mark diagonal lines across the cardstock to create a pattern for your stripes.
- Cut strips of red and green construction paper in various widths. These will be your candy cane stripes.
3. Assemble the Stripes
- Start gluing the strips onto the white cardstock, following the diagonal lines as a guide. Overlap the edges slightly for a seamless look.
- Use different alternating colors to create a playful design.
4. Add Sparkle
- Optionally, sprinkle some glitter on the glue before it dries for a festive sparkle effect.
5. Finish and Display
- Allow your creation to dry completely. If you want your Candy Cane Stripes to hang, attach a ribbon or string to the top of your cardstock.
Tips & Variations:
- Color Choice: Swap out red and green for any colors that match your holiday decor.
- Texture Variety: Try using patterned paper or fabric instead of regular construction paper for added texture.
- Size Adjustment: Modify the size of your stripes based on where you plan to use your Candy Cane Stripes.
- Use Alternative Adhesives: Hot glue can be used for a quicker application if working with heavier materials.
Frequently Asked Questions:
1. Can I use different types of paper?
Yes! Feel free to experiment with textured or patterned paper for unique effects.
2. How do I store my Candy Cane Stripes?
Store them flat in a dry, cool place, or hang them carefully to preserve their shape.
3. What if I don’t have craft glue?
You can use tape or a glue stick if that’s what you have on hand.
4. Can I incorporate other decorations?
Absolutely! Add stickers, markers, or other embellishments to personalize your design further.
